how can forecast, about a 'clear sky', or an 'approaching storm' be made by measuring the atmospheric pressure of a given region?​

If the pressure of air in the atmosphere is high, there are chances of clear sky and if the pressure in the atmosphere is low, there is changes of approaching storms.
